Arabic builds its vocabulary on consonantal roots, usually of three letters, poured into fixed patterns: one root yields the verb, the doer, the thing done and the place it happens. Names are drawn straight from that system, which is why a single root can stand behind a whole family of related names that look and sound like kin.
